Wetherspoon to Invest £4 Million in Transforming Former Glasgow Nightclub.

In an exciting development for Glasgow’s nightlife scene, JD Wetherspoon has announced its plans to invest a staggering £4 million in the renovation of a former city nightclub. The renowned UK-wide pub chain is set to breathe new life into the once-thriving Waverley Tea Rooms and Tusk nightclub, located in the vibrant Shawlands area.

The historic A-listed building, formerly owned by G1 Group (now the Scotsman Group), has sat vacant since 2017, leaving a void in the local entertainment landscape. However, this iconic structure holds a rich history, having originally housed the Waverley Picture House, which first welcomed moviegoers back in 1922.

In an exciting turn of events, Glasgow City Council granted approval for Wetherspoon’s plans to establish a new venue on this site in 2020. Recently, on Friday, the pub giant successfully obtained permission to modify the premises license for the building, marking a significant step forward in the project.

During the hearing with Glasgow’s Licensing Board, representatives from Wetherspoons revealed their ambitious vision, stating that the company is ready to invest £4 million in the extensive renovation of this remarkable property. Once completed, the revamped venue is expected to provide employment opportunities for approximately 60 to 70 staff members, further contributing to the local economy.

Archie MacIver, the licensing lawyer representing Wetherspoons, shared insights into the license variation, explaining that it would remove the nightclub-oriented elements and transform it into a more traditional Wetherspoon-style public house. The license amendment included the removal of live entertainment and an adjusted closing time of midnight. With a generous capacity of 680 people, the pub aims to offer a welcoming space for patrons to gather and enjoy their time.

Mr. MacIver expressed the company’s enthusiasm for this project, highlighting Wetherspoon’s established presence in Glasgow. He mentioned the previous establishment, the Sir John Stirling Maxwell located in Shawlands Arcade, which recently closed its doors after proudly serving the community for 25 years. The acquisition of the new site, the focus of this application, demonstrates Wetherspoon’s commitment to continuing their legacy in the area.

Emphasizing the historical significance of the venue, Mr. MacIver assured that the £4 million redevelopment would not only revive the building’s former glory but also enhance its overall splendor. The transformation aims to restore this architectural gem to its former grandeur, drawing inspiration from the days of yore.

It’s worth noting that JD Wetherspoon previously operated a pub in close proximity to the site, the Sir John Stirling Maxwell on Kilmarnock Road, which unfortunately closed earlier this year. However, with the upcoming redevelopment of Shawlands Arcade, for which planning permission in principle was granted in March, the area is set to undergo a remarkable transformation.
